Laurus Nobilis: Vine

Part two of a two-part, Laurus Nobilis features an abstract interpretation of laurels, depicted in inviting shades of blue-gray and touches of natural browns. This plant, historically cherished by the ancient Greeks and Romans as a symbol of wisdom and victory. The bay laurel, used for centuries to crown scholars and athletes, evokes a feeling of tradition and endurance. These paintings beautifully merge artistic abstraction with the deep cultural significance of Laurus nobilis.
